The Shocking Truth Most Indie Card Game Devs Overlook Is Simple Game Feel
The Shocking Truth Most Indie Card Game Devs Overlook is how physical interaction shapes fun. Sleek rules matter less than smooth shuffling and clear icons. Studies indicate players stick with games that feel pleasant in their hands.
Hidden Pattern Drives Replay Decisions
Early playtesters often miss this pattern. They talk about art, yet return for smooth turns. Research shows sessions with low friction get shared more. That hidden habit quietly guides long term success.
One line takeaway: polish turns first, graphics second.
